- The distance between Timimoun, Algeria and Barabinsk, Russia is approximately 6,636 km or 4,123 mi.
- To reach Timimoun in this distance one would set out from Barabinsk bearing 278.6° or W and follow the great circles arc to approach Timimoun bearing 220.1° or SW .
- Timimoun has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h) whereas Barabinsk has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Timimoun is in or near the subtropical desert biome whereas Barabinsk is in or near the boreal moist for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 23.1 °C (41.6°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 14 °C (25.2°F) less in Timimoun.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 362.5 mm (14.3 in) less which is equivalent to 362.5 l/m² (8.9 US gal/ft²) or 3,625,000 l/ha (387,537 US gal/ac) less. About 0 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 26° higher in Timimoun than in Barabinsk.
